Fraise à fileter et axe C

  • Auteur de la discussion Nico 22
  • Date de début
N

Nico 22

Nouveau
Bonsoir je travaille sur des tours bi broche bi tourelle sans axe Y en fanuc 18ti.
Ma question, est il possible de réaliser un taraudage M6*1 avec une fraise à fileter en programmant avec l'axe C et l'axe X et l'axe Z??
Je débute en programmation, je suis un peu perdu
 
L

laboureau

Compagnon
Bonjour Nico 22
Déjà un M6 la fraise à fileter va être petite,
pourquoi pas un taraud direct ?
Cordialement.
jpal7@
 
J

JLuc69

Compagnon
Si tu le fais en XY, je ne pense pas que tu seras en hors course X...
 
W

Woz

Compagnon
Je pense que ça risque d’être compliqué, pour faire du fraisage type un hexagone oui c’est possible, mais un filetage je ne pense pas.
 
N

Nico 22

Nouveau
Bonjour, j'ai trop de casse de taraudages alors mon fournisseur de taraudage me propose une fraise à fileter
 
N

Nico 22

Nouveau
Je pense que ça risque d’être compliqué, pour faire du fraisage type un hexagone oui c’est possible, mais un filetage je ne pense pas.
C'est bien ce que je me disais, programmer un hexagonal, oui pas de problème avec C et X.
 
W

Woz

Compagnon
Le problème pour un filetage à la fraise, c’est en continue, ou il faudrait faire tourner l’axe C, mais sans axe Y, avec les axes X et Z ça me semble compliqué voir non réalisable surtout dans un diamètre si petit.
 
K

kerdour29

Ouvrier
C'est faisable, faut voir la programmation par contre. Sur fanuc avec les codes g112/113 la machine utilise C et X pour interpoler un axe Y. Ensuite tu programme comme en XY, en remplaçanty par C (y'a aussi des histoire de rayon/diamètre).
 
N

Nico 22

Nouveau
C'est faisable, faut voir la programmation par contre. Sur fanuc avec les codes g112/113 la machine utilise C et X pour interpoler un axe Y. Ensuite tu programme comme en XY, en remplaçanty par C (y'a aussi des histoire de rayon/diamètre).
Je vais potasser tout ça ce soir, j'essaierai de vous envoyer le programme de filetage
 
W

Woz

Compagnon
Je regarderai si j’ai le temps demain avec mon logiciel de programmation pour simuler un bout de programme avec l’axe C faire un M4.
 
I

inmik

Apprenti
Bonsoir,
j'ai eu ce problème avec une machine qui n'acceptai pas l’interpolation hélicoïdale.
Je vous transmet le code que j’ai bricolé de tête ce soir.

Il faut l’adapter à votre machine, vos outils mais ça marche bien.
%
O0001(ESSAI FILETAGE XZC)
(VARIABLES POUR FILTAGE)
#500=1 (PAS DU FILETAGE)
#501=5 (PROFONDEUR DU FILETAGE TOUJOURS EN +)
#503=#501+1 (LONGUEUR FILETEE + 1MM/FACE Z0)
#504=[360/#500](LONGUEUR POUR 1 TOUR)
#505=[#504*#501](NOMBRE DE TOURS POUR FILETER)

T0101 (FRAISE A FILETER / TOURBILLONNER)
G0 Z10.
X100. M8
M303 S3500 (MARCHE OUTIL ENTRAINE M3 S3500 EXEMPLE)
M117 (C ON)
G28 H0. (POM C)
G98 (OU G94 = MM/MINUTES)
G0 X2.Z1. (APPROCHE)
G1 X2. (LE X DEPEND DU DIAMETRE DE LA FRAISE)
(PASSE POUR LE FILETAGE EN Z ET C ...C EST EN RELATIF)
G1 Z-#501 H#505 (H+ OU H- SUIVANT LES MACHINES POUR SENS DU FILETAGE)
G0 X0. (DEGAGEMENT)
Z1. M9 (DEGAGEMENT)

(AJOUTER DES PASSES SI BESOIN)

M305 (ARRET OUTIL ENTRAINE)
M105 (ARRET C)
G28 U0. (POM X)
G28 W0. (POM Z)
M30
%

Il faut le tester à vide j'ai peut-être fait des boulettes.
Cordialement.
 
I

inmik

Apprenti
Bonjour Nico 22,
j'ai fouillé dans mes archives et j'ai retrouvé la syntaxe qui fonctionne:
%
O0001(ESSAI FILETAGE XZC)
(VARIABLES POUR FILTAGE)
#500=1 (PAS DU FILETAGE)
#501=5 (PROFONDEUR DU FILETAGE TOUJOURS EN +)
#501=[#501+1] (LONGUEUR FILETEE + 1MM/FACE Z0)
#504=[#501/#500](LONGUEUR / PAS = NOMBRE DE TOURS)
#505=[#504*360](NOMBRE DE TOURS EN DEGRES)

T0101 (FRAISE A FILETER / TOURBILLONNER)
G0 Z10.
X100. M8
M303 S3500 (MARCHE OUTIL ENTRAINE M3 S3500 EXEMPLE)
M117 (C ON)
G28 H0. (POM C)
G94 (OU G98 = MM/MINUTES)
G0 X2.Z1. (APPROCHE)
G1 X2. F2000(LE X DEPEND DU DIAMETRE DE LA FRAISE)
(PASSE POUR LE FILETAGE EN Z ET C ... EN RELATIF)
G1 W-#501 H-#505 (H+ OU H- SUIVANT LES MACHINES POUR SENS DU FILETAGE)
G0 X0. (DEGAGEMENT)
Z1. M9 (DEGAGEMENT)
(AJOUTER DES PASSES SI BESOIN)
M305 (ARRET OUTIL ENTRAINE)
M105 (ARRET C)
G28 U0. (POM X)
G28 W0. (POM Z)
M30
%

A+
 
N

Nico 22

Nouveau
Bonjour Nico 22,
j'ai fouillé dans mes archives et j'ai retrouvé la syntaxe qui fonctionne:
%
O0001(ESSAI FILETAGE XZC)
(VARIABLES POUR FILTAGE)
#500=1 (PAS DU FILETAGE)
#501=5 (PROFONDEUR DU FILETAGE TOUJOURS EN +)
#501=[#501+1] (LONGUEUR FILETEE + 1MM/FACE Z0)
#504=[#501/#500](LONGUEUR / PAS = NOMBRE DE TOURS)
#505=[#504*360](NOMBRE DE TOURS EN DEGRES)

T0101 (FRAISE A FILETER / TOURBILLONNER)
G0 Z10.
X100. M8
M303 S3500 (MARCHE OUTIL ENTRAINE M3 S3500 EXEMPLE)
M117 (C ON)
G28 H0. (POM C)
G94 (OU G98 = MM/MINUTES)
G0 X2.Z1. (APPROCHE)
G1 X2. F2000(LE X DEPEND DU DIAMETRE DE LA FRAISE)
(PASSE POUR LE FILETAGE EN Z ET C ... EN RELATIF)
G1 W-#501 H-#505 (H+ OU H- SUIVANT LES MACHINES POUR SENS DU FILETAGE)
G0 X0. (DEGAGEMENT)
Z1. M9 (DEGAGEMENT)
(AJOUTER DES PASSES SI BESOIN)
M305 (ARRET OUTIL ENTRAINE)
M105 (ARRET C)
G28 U0. (POM X)
G28 W0. (POM Z)
M30
%

A+
Merci pour ton aide, c'est sympa de ta part..
 
N

Nico 22

Nouveau
Du coup en cherchant un peu aussi de mon côté j'ai réussi à programmer le filetage

M5
G98 G18 G40 G97 G80
T1010 M8
M143 S4000
G0 Z2 C0
X0
Z-8,1 F1000
G1 X[6-4,6] (diam du taraudage - diam de la fraise) W[1/0,4] H-90 F3820
W1 H-360 F4775
X0 W[1/0,4] H-90
G0 Z2 M129
M5
M145
G99
G28 U0
M1

Voilà programme réalisé sur un miyano bne sans axe y sur la tourelle 2.
 
  • Réagir
Reactions: Woz
L

lolo

Compagnon
Les programmes ci-dessus ne semblent Valides uniquement pour un filetage centré à l'axe Broche , exact ?

Pour un fietage positionné n'importe ou en X, il faudra passer par le mode G12.1 (ou G12 ou G112 selon armoire ) qui fait tranformer la machine les programmations XY en mouvement XC.
Puis ensuite une serie de G2 (ou G3) pour le filet
Souvent G17 UH
G12.1
G1 X..C.. ( les valeurs suivant C sont en fait des coordonnées Y )
.. Usinages en mode XC
G13 ( Annulation G12.1)

Chez Fanuc, le G12.1 est une Option, appelé Polar Interpolation ou un truc approchant selon fabricant.

Vous devez tous avoir un chapitre qui traite de ce type de programmation dans vos manuels respectifs je pense.
 
N

Nico 22

Nouveau
Les programmes ci-dessus ne semblent Valides uniquement pour un filetage centré à l'axe Broche , exact ?

Pour un fietage positionné n'importe ou en X, il faudra passer par le mode G12.1 (ou G12 ou G112 selon armoire ) qui fait tranformer la machine les programmations XY en mouvement XC.
Puis ensuite une serie de G2 (ou G3) pour le filet
Souvent G17 UH
G12.1
G1 X..C.. ( les valeurs suivant C sont en fait des coordonnées Y )
.. Usinages en mode XC
G13 ( Annulation G12.1)

Chez Fanuc, le G12.1 est une Option, appelé Polar Interpolation ou un truc approchant selon fabricant.

Vous devez tous avoir un chapitre qui traite de ce type de programmation dans vos manuels respectifs je pense.
Salut Lolo, c'est exact, les 2 exemples de programme sont pour travailler au centre, après comme tu dis, si on fait en excentré,il faut passer en interpolation avec les corrections d'outils et le G2/G3..et qui est plus complexe en programmation
 
I

inmik

Apprenti
Salut à tous,
il y a sûrement moyen de s'amuser avec ce petit programme de chez Vargus...


La version en ligne est pas mal...
 
N

Nico 22

Nouveau
Salut à tous,
il y a sûrement moyen de s'amuser avec ce petit programme de chez Vargus...


La version en ligne est pas mal...
Oui je l'utilise aussi mais c'est souvent avec le "x" et le "y".
Après c'est très complet comme application.
 
Y

Youry

Ouvrier
Bonjour Nico 22
Déjà un M6 la fraise à fileter va être petite,
pourquoi pas un taraud direct ?
Cordialement.
jpal7@


petite la fraise? non non
chez nous les fraises à fileter commencent à M1.6!! et jusqu'a M12 en carbure monobloc , après c'est à plaquette,

comme le dit Nico 22 on cassait trop de tarauds... et des fois la profondeur de percage n'est pas suffisante pour utiliser un taraud

d'autre part certains traitement thermique rajoute de l'épaisseur aux pièces, quelques centièmes, et bien ça suffit pour ne plus faire rentrer le tampon, donc à la fraise à fileter on fait rentrer le maxi avant traitement....
 
W

Woz

Compagnon
Salut à tous,
il y a sûrement moyen de s'amuser avec ce petit programme de chez Vargus...
Oui je m’en sert aussi régulièrement pour récupérer des données de différents filetages et taraudages.
C’est un très bon outil :)
 
R

Rico25

Nouveau
Bonjour ,pourquoi ne pas utiliser du taraud a refouler, j utilise souvent ce type de taraud ,ca casse pas ,je m arrete a 0.5 du fond du percage, 200 taraudages M2 dans une piece sans souci
 
L

leen

Ouvrier
bonjour
c'est vrai que le taraud à refouler c'est le top mais en laboratoire souvent interdit car c'est des nids à bactéries au niveau des filets, mais si tu peux hésites surtout pas .
 
  • Réagir
Reactions: Woz
N

Nico 22

Nouveau
C'est vrai que les petits tarauds à refouler ça fonctionne vraiment bien.. mais depuis que je l'utilise sur du npt 1/4 min le taux de rebuts a diminué énormément
 
I

Izac

Nouveau
Bonjour je souhaiterais savoir comment inmik a déterminé son avance F2000 ( avec sa rotation S3500) sur son filetage avec les axes CZ.
Bien cordialement
 
I

inmik

Apprenti
Bonsoir Izac, pour déterminer la rotation je suis parti sur une fraise à fileter M6 diamètre 4.8 / 3 dents, 55 mètres minutes qui nous donne environ 3600 tours minutes.
Pour l'avance c'est plus compliqué car 2000 mm/min ça fait 0.18 à la dent ! violent..
Je vous met le liens d'une discutions antérieure qui aborde le sujet, vitesse d'avance circonférentielle...
Je ne retrouve plus le formule, mais ça dépend aussi de la vélocité de l'axe C de la machine.
Bien cordialement
 

Sujets similaires

J
Réponses
7
Affichages
998
JLuc69
J
J
Réponses
1
Affichages
1 196
JLuc69
J
P
Réponses
15
Affichages
1 191
laurent12100
L
T
Réponses
1
Affichages
791
Teddy55
T
V
Réponses
11
Affichages
613
slk
Otatiaro
Réponses
18
Affichages
565
outlander2.2
O
S
Réponses
18
Affichages
27 752
rebarbe
rebarbe
Haut